Ligand Pharmaceuticals (NASDAQ:LGND) Price Target Raised to $276.00 at Citigroup

Ligand Pharmaceuticals (NASDAQ:LGNDFree Report) had its price target lifted by Citigroup from $270.00 to $276.00 in a report published on Tuesday,Benzinga reports. Citigroup currently has a buy rating on the biotechnology company’s stock.

Several other analysts also recently issued reports on LGND. Bank of America initiated coverage on shares of Ligand Pharmaceuticals in a research note on Wednesday, March 11th. They issued a “buy” rating and a $244.00 price objective for the company. Wall Street Zen lowered shares of Ligand Pharmaceuticals from a “buy” rating to a “hold” rating in a research report on Saturday, March 7th. Oppenheimer raised their price target on Ligand Pharmaceuticals from $275.00 to $277.00 and gave the company an “outperform” rating in a research note on Friday, February 27th. Stifel Nicolaus increased their target price on shares of Ligand Pharmaceuticals from $220.00 to $230.00 and gave the stock a “buy” rating in a report on Wednesday, December 10th. Finally, Weiss Ratings reissued a “hold (c)” rating on shares of Ligand Pharmaceuticals in a research report on Monday, December 29th. Seven research analysts have rated the stock with a Buy rating and one has assigned a Hold rating to the company’s stock. According to MarketBeat, the company has a consensus rating of “Moderate Buy” and an average price target of $245.86.

Ligand Pharmaceuticals (NASDAQ:LGNDGet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Thursday, February 26th. The biotechnology company reported $2.02 ear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$1.46 by $0.56. Ligand Pharmaceuticals had a net margin of 46.42% and a return on equity of 13.86%. The business had revenue of $59.67 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$55.59 million. During the same quarter in the prior year, the firm posted $1.27 earnings per share. The business’s revenue for the quarter was up 39.5% on a year-over-year basis. Ligand Pharmaceuticals has set its FY 2026 guidance at 8.000-9.000 EPS. On average, analysts predict that Ligand Pharmaceuticals will post 1.73 earnings per share for the current year.

Ligand Pharmaceuticals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Ligand Pharmaceuticals, Inc is a biopharmaceutical company that acquires, develops and out-licenses proprietary technologies designed to help pharmaceutical and biotechnology companies discover and develop novel medicines. Operating primarily through its research services and royalty-generating businesses, Ligand focuses on building a diversified portfolio of technology platforms and partnering with industry leaders to advance therapeutic candidates across multiple disease areas.
